What You'll Do

  • Provide occupational therapy services for elementary and high school students
  • Conduct evaluations and develop individualized treatment plans and IEP goals
  • Participate in IEP meetings and collaborate as an active member of the interdisciplinary team
  • Partner with teachers, special education staff, and families to support student success
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ation in compliance with school and state requirements
